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							76c4b7ed4c
							
						
					 | 
					
						
						
							
							Converted the Irc class to use IrcCommandDispatcher.
						
						
						
						
						
						
					 | 
					
						2003-10-14 04:48:45 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							b692681e1c
							
						
					 | 
					
						
						
							
							Found bug in utils.sortBy, mentioned by Tim Peters on Python-dev.  Fixed, and tested.
						
						
						
						
						
						
					 | 
					
						2003-10-14 03:47:35 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							8e37d2ae88
							
						
					 | 
					
						
						
							
							Made loadPluginModule case-insensitive.
						
						
						
						
						
						
					 | 
					
						2003-10-14 03:34:47 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							56016de47c
							
						
					 | 
					
						
						
							
							Added more information to the load help.
						
						
						
						
						
						
					 | 
					
						2003-10-14 03:06:47 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							6150a21ba3
							
						
					 | 
					
						
						
							
							Added an assert to unAction.
						
						
						
						
						
						
					 | 
					
						2003-10-14 00:39:54 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							aa1b992643
							
						
					 | 
					
						
						
							
							Added error reporting to regexp-based callCommands.
						
						
						
						
						
						
					 | 
					
						2003-10-13 23:20:15 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							a5042e2a3d
							
						
					 | 
					
						
						
							
							Oops, debug.reset opens all the fds into the same file!
						
						
						
						
						
						
					 | 
					
						2003-10-13 23:07:07 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							1d5dfa070d
							
						
					 | 
					
						
						
							
							Added an optional key argument to cycle.
						
						
						
						
						
						
					 | 
					
						2003-10-13 03:58:37 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							68a84e17b0
							
						
					 | 
					
						
						
							
							Changed date from 2002 to 2003.
						
						
						
						
						
						
					 | 
					
						2003-10-12 15:12:18 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							a0fe5410c0
							
						
					 | 
					
						
						
							
							Fixed bug in perlReToReplacer where escaped slashes would stay in the output.
						
						
						
						
						
						
					 | 
					
						2003-10-12 13:11:53 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							a1dc34643b
							
						
					 | 
					
						
						
							
							Moved setting of debug variables earlier so nothing would print when debug.stderr is false.
						
						
						
						
						
						
					 | 
					
						2003-10-12 12:43:24 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							9eff6d997e
							
						
					 | 
					
						
						
							
							Removed/commented out some debug.printfs.
						
						
						
						
						
						
					 | 
					
						2003-10-12 12:42:43 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							7528215674
							
						
					 | 
					
						
						
							
							Fixed handling of secure flag by IrcUser.setAuth.
						
						
						
						
						
						
					 | 
					
						2003-10-11 10:20:15 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							5e3c5fc703
							
						
					 | 
					
						
						
							
							Faster implementations for all/any.
						
						
						
						
						
						
					 | 
					
						2003-10-11 03:20:51 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							701380de7c
							
						
					 | 
					
						
						
							
							Updated version.
						
						
						
						
						
						
					 | 
					
						2003-10-10 23:18:01 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							7fe7c03d81
							
						
					 | 
					
						
						
							
							Removed the whole dealio with PRINTF and whatnot.
						
						
						
						
						
						
					 | 
					
						2003-10-10 06:03:02 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Daniel DiPaolo
							
						 
					 | 
					
						
						
						
						
							
						
						
							d9d141a8e7
							
						
					 | 
					
						
						
							
							* Added the most horribly named command ever - utils.ellipsisify
						
						
						
						
						
						
					 | 
					
						2003-10-10 04:28:49 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							18a8f81985
							
						
					 | 
					
						
						
							
							Fixed bug in list where _exec would show.
						
						
						
						
						
						
					 | 
					
						2003-10-09 18:06:46 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							b7f4cbe7d8
							
						
					 | 
					
						
						
							
							Added fix for msvcrt.heapmin not working in Windows 9x.
						
						
						
						
						
						
					 | 
					
						2003-10-09 17:24:28 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							155aeebe42
							
						
					 | 
					
						
						
							
							Added dccIP and unDccIP.
						
						
						
						
						
						
					 | 
					
						2003-10-09 16:12:53 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							8eed3f0982
							
						
					 | 
					
						
						
							
							Stupid __eq__ not being used in __ne__...
						
						
						
						
						
						
					 | 
					
						2003-10-09 05:46:35 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							ce0002f454
							
						
					 | 
					
						
						
							
							Made IrcString more efficient/better, added a test for it.
						
						
						
						
						
						
					 | 
					
						2003-10-09 05:34:44 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							aee2b1555b
							
						
					 | 
					
						
						
							
							Fixed to handle secure flag properly.
						
						
						
						
						
						
					 | 
					
						2003-10-09 05:09:05 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							e96c1359fd
							
						
					 | 
					
						
						
							
							Added addressedRegexps set to PrivmsgCommandAndRegexp.
						
						
						
						
						
						
					 | 
					
						2003-10-09 04:29:37 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							657db2c1f7
							
						
					 | 
					
						
						
							
							Changed the uses of queue to a smallqueue.
						
						
						
						
						
						
					 | 
					
						2003-10-09 04:01:27 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							ae61e178ec
							
						
					 | 
					
						
						
							
							Added reset() to smallqueue.
						
						
						
						
						
						
					 | 
					
						2003-10-09 03:59:36 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							b0f5674f91
							
						
					 | 
					
						
						
							
							Fixed bug #820262.
						
						
						
						
						
						
					 | 
					
						2003-10-08 22:38:27 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							e903411ef3
							
						
					 | 
					
						
						
							
							Forgot a parenthese.
						
						
						
						
						
						
					 | 
					
						2003-10-08 22:33:09 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							4b0ecc94e5
							
						
					 | 
					
						
						
							
							Changed __all__ to the empty list so people won't misuse fix.py.
						
						
						
						
						
						
					 | 
					
						2003-10-08 20:57:29 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							8eaf73abf3
							
						
					 | 
					
						
						
							
							Made sure profiling data is logged to a file.
						
						
						
						
						
						
					 | 
					
						2003-10-08 19:10:06 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							206e14fcf4
							
						
					 | 
					
						
						
							
							Oops, didn't check to see if the file was there before stat'ing it.
						
						
						
						
						
						
					 | 
					
						2003-10-08 14:15:05 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							2fb9273518
							
						
					 | 
					
						
						
							
							Fix for RFE #818993, smarter PeriodicFileDownloader.
						
						
						
						
						
						
					 | 
					
						2003-10-08 13:20:16 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							e25f0653c5
							
						
					 | 
					
						
						
							
							Fixed MiscCommands.doPrivmsg to use an IrcObjectProxy when sending stuff to replyWhenNotCommand.
						
						
						
						
						
						
					 | 
					
						2003-10-07 17:50:45 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							0c303de664
							
						
					 | 
					
						
						
							
							Being even nicer to Windows.
						
						
						
						
						
						
					 | 
					
						2003-10-05 21:21:07 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							b1495a1718
							
						
					 | 
					
						
						
							
							Added a docstring.
						
						
						
						
						
						
					 | 
					
						2003-10-05 20:40:45 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							1fa9f7990b
							
						
					 | 
					
						
						
							
							Changes to be nice to Windows.
						
						
						
						
						
						
					 | 
					
						2003-10-05 20:40:34 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							0a46f90104
							
						
					 | 
					
						
						
							
							Renamed baseplugin to plugins.
						
						
						
						
						
						
					 | 
					
						2003-10-05 12:48:28 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							970c819e79
							
						
					 | 
					
						
						
							
							Changed fix.py to munge __builtins__ rather than requiring a "from fix import *" statement.
						
						
						
						
						
						
					 | 
					
						2003-10-05 12:47:19 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							8ef808a039
							
						
					 | 
					
						
						
							
							Some bugs were being shadowed for some reason, and there were bugs in the handling of the owner privilege that hadn't been found because those tests had been shadowed.
						
						
						
						
						
						
					 | 
					
						2003-10-05 11:42:58 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							66fc538a3a
							
						
					 | 
					
						
						
							
							Changed the anti-capability prefix to - instead of !.
						
						
						
						
						
						
					 | 
					
						2003-10-05 11:13:20 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							5025f200c6
							
						
					 | 
					
						
						
							
							Broke reset up into two component functions which will have to be called separately to fix testing in Windows, I'm sure.
						
						
						
						
						
						
					 | 
					
						2003-10-05 03:39:57 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							e5525cd7da
							
						
					 | 
					
						
						
							
							Incremented version number and added two docstrings.
						
						
						
						
						
						
					 | 
					
						2003-10-05 03:33:15 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							bbf367f1d3
							
						
					 | 
					
						
						
							
							Added __all__.
						
						
						
						
						
						
					 | 
					
						2003-10-04 14:58:04 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							606ac0519e
							
						
					 | 
					
						
						
							
							Added docstring, imports.
						
						
						
						
						
						
					 | 
					
						2003-10-04 14:57:55 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							3af3b4c985
							
						
					 | 
					
						
						
							
							__all__'ed baseplugin.py, updated other plugins to reflect that.
						
						
						
						
						
						
					 | 
					
						2003-10-04 13:53:13 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							53c6542aa0
							
						
					 | 
					
						
						
							
							Added docstrings and removed an unused import.
						
						
						
						
						
						
					 | 
					
						2003-10-04 13:24:51 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							69493ebf88
							
						
					 | 
					
						
						
							
							Added docstrings.
						
						
						
						
						
						
					 | 
					
						2003-10-04 13:22:40 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							d4ba047b2f
							
						
					 | 
					
						
						
							
							Added smallqueue class.
						
						
						
						
						
						
					 | 
					
						2003-10-04 13:20:41 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							0ffaa5d3fe
							
						
					 | 
					
						
						
							
							Removed some useless imports.
						
						
						
						
						
						
					 | 
					
						2003-10-04 13:09:34 +00: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Jeremy Fincher
							
						 
					 | 
					
						
						
						
						
							
						
						
							72af23bb00
							
						
					 | 
					
						
						
							
							Added docstrings, removed ny.
						
						
						
						
						
						
					 | 
					
						2003-10-04 13:07:15 +00:00 | 
					
					
						
						
							
							
							
						
					 |